Frequently Asked Questions about Dentist with Dr. Riettie in Pickering

What services does a General Dentist (Dentist) like Dr. Riettie typically provide?
A General Dentist like Dr. Riettie is the primary dental care provider for patients of all ages, offering a wide range of services including preventative care (check-ups, cleanings, X-rays, fluoride, sealants), restorative treatments (fillings, crowns, bridges), basic endodontics (root canals on less complex teeth), simple extractions, initial management of gum disease, and cosmetic procedures (like whitening or bonding if offered). Dr. Riettie also educates patients on oral hygiene and refers to specialists for more complex needs.
Do I need a referral from my general dentist to see a dental specialist (e.g., Orthodontist, Periodontist)?
While some dental specialists may accept patients directly, it is often recommended and sometimes required by the specialist or insurance plans to have a referral from a general dentist like Dr. Riettie. A referral ensures the specialist has relevant background information and that the visit is appropriate. If Dr. Riettie identifies a need for specialist care, they will provide a referral to ensure coordinated care. Check with the specific specialist's office or your insurance if unsure.
Do I need a referral to see a general dentist like Dr. Riettie?
No, you generally do not need a referral from a physician or another healthcare provider to see a general dentist like Dr. Riettie for a check-up, cleaning, or consultation. You can usually book an appointment directly with Rouge Valley Dental Centre.
How often should I (or my child) visit Dr. Riettie for a check-up and cleaning?
For most patients, preventative check-ups and cleanings are generally recommended every 6 months. However, Dr. Riettie will recommend a personalized schedule based on your individual oral health needs, risk factors for cavities or gum disease, and existing conditions. Some may need visits every 3-4 months, while others might have slightly longer intervals. Follow Dr. Riettie's specific recommendation.
Are dental X-rays safe, and how often are they needed?
Dental X-rays are very safe, especially modern digital X-rays which use minimal radiation. Protective lead aprons are used. X-rays are taken only when diagnostically necessary (e.g., for new patients, to check for decay, assess bone health, or plan complex treatments). Dr. Riettie will determine the frequency based on your individual needs, adhering to guidelines like ALARA (As Low As Reasonably Achievable).

Is dental treatment generally covered by provincial health plans like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) in ON?
In ON, provincial health plans (like OHIP) typically do NOT cover most routine or major dental procedures performed in private dental clinics for the general population. Some specific, limited dental surgeries performed in a hospital setting might be covered. Most dental care costs are paid out-of-pocket or through private dental insurance. Verify any potential public coverage and check your private dental insurance details before treatment.
